Abstract :
The present monitor system cannot timely validate alarm information, the incuurate alarm is a serious problem. To solve the problem, based on DSP and PIC, an infrared monitoring system was designed, which can automatically monitor target range all day. The system kept the chip NT96211 which has strong image processing ability, GPRS modules, CMOS image sensor, pyroelectric infrared sensor together, and realized the function of automatic trigger photos and MMS and so on. The actual application results show that the system had strong function, good stability, fast response, which can be widely used in site, supermarket, warehouse, family and other places monitoring.
